Google Announces Free WiFi For The Holidays
Google [GOOG] has decided to give away free WiFi at over 47 airports in the United States over the holiday period, from now until the 15th of January 2010, people will be able to access the free WiFi at airports in the US as well as on Virgin America Flights.

When you’re traveling this holiday season, you can enjoy free WiFi at 47 participating airports and on every Virgin America flight. Just bring a WiFi-enabled laptop or mobile device and stay connected to family and friends for free while you travel now through January 15, 2010.
Starting Monday, November 16, 2009, you’ll be able to win prizes by submitting a photo of yourself using the WiFi in any participating airport or on a Virgin America flight. In addition to being able to win great stuff, we’ll feature winning photos on this website.
